How they compare
Belarus currently reports 3.36 years against 2.99 years in SDG: Latin America and the Caribbean, a difference of 0.37 years.
That makes Belarus's figure about 1.1 times SDG: Latin America and the Caribbean's.
Across all 26 years both countries report, Belarus has been ahead every year.
Belarus ranks 57th and SDG: Latin America and the Caribbean ranks 60th of 196 countries.
Belarus has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Belarus | SDG: Latin America and the Caribbean |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 2.6 years | 1.65 years | 0.9503 years | Belarus |
| 2000s | 3.28 years | 1.89 years | 1.39 years | Belarus |
| 2010s | 4.09 years | 2.48 years | 1.61 years | Belarus |
| 2020s | 3.61 years | 2.92 years | 0.6838 years | Belarus |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
